About the Role

We are seeking an experienced and passionate Regional Manager to join our Donor Ministries team in the Northeast region. As a Regional Manager, you will play a vital role in cultivating meaningful relationships with ministry supporters and identifying, developing, and deepening new relationships with prospective ministry partners. Your goal will be to grow a strong base of support for BGEA's ministries, ensuring the continuation of our evangelistic efforts for decades to come.

Key Responsibilities

  • Communicate the vision and mission of BGEA to donors and prospective ministry partners, inspiring them to support our evangelistic efforts
  • Develop and implement a strategic plan to build relationships with select ministry partners and prospects, resulting in meaningful contact and relationship building
  • Maintain and shepherd a caseload of 100 Top current gift ministry partners and 200 Priority ministry partners, including current gift and deferred gift donors, and prospects
  • Initiate and build relationships with ministry partners and prospects through personal visits, events, gatherings, and referrals
  • Complete an acceptable level of partner interactions, including visits, contacts, touches, happenings, and events
  • Possess firm and growing knowledge and confidence to assist partners with current gift and deferred gift opportunities
  • Deliver prompt follow-up from lead generation efforts and large gifts
  • Report various areas of performance to the Director, Regional Managers, as required
  • Consistently participate in required Donor Ministries team meetings
  • Relate to and communicate effectively with Donor Ministries team, other Regional Managers, and all BGEA staff
